The belt could be wearing but not show any problems. When the belt stretches the timing will jump and the engine will run rough. If the belt breaks then the engine wont run at all.
AnswerIf this engine has a timing belt, there is no way to know if a timing belt is going bad unless you look at it and it is frayed or cracked. That is why they are replaced at a predetermined mileage interval. The belt can look good and be ready to fail. Replace the belt according to the mileage interval listed in your owner's manual.AnswerIt is highly unlikely the Taurus/Sable has a timing BELT - unless it is a Taurus SHO model.See "Related Questions" below for more
